Last Tuesday July 17, Minister of Oil, Rasheed Badamag signed an agreement to organize the second conference which is going to be held in 2002 by IBC Gulf Conference. The agreement was signed by the Eng. Mosaed Ahmad Al-Sabbari, the the head of the High preparatory Committee and Ms. Susan Webb the the company’s conference director. The signing protocol was attended by members of the preparatory committee of the conference and a number of officials from the Ministry of Oil. In a press statement, the Head of the Preparatory Committee emphasized greatly the importance of the Second Yemeni Conference. “The conference will be a positive step towards the inspiration and prosperity which is sought by the political leadership of Yemen, represented by H.E. President Ali Abdullah Saleh,” Al-Sabbery said. He added that the conference comes as an extension of the success of the first conference. He concluded that the main aim of the conference was to introduce to investors the potential of investment in the oil sector in Yemen, and to present the reality of Yemeni industry and investment opportunities so as to attract Arab and other foreign investors. Meanwhile Ms. Susan Webb of the IBC Gulf Conference thanked the Supreme Preparatory Committee for the support it had given to the IBC Gulf Conference, adding that their main objective in the conference was to showcase the substantial range of projects that were open to international investment. At the end of the signing ceremony, Ms. Webb expressed her hopes that the conferences would contribute in promoting awareness of investment possibilities in Yemen through such conferences.
